What is Wchook.dll?

A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is like a digital toolbox that stores code and data that multiple programs can use. These files help software programs run more efficiently by allowing them to share resources. When a program needs to perform a specific function, it can call on the DLL file to access the necessary code and data.

In the case of wchook.dll, this file is a part of the McAfee Endpoint Security Threat Prevention software. The wchook.dll file plays a crucial role in the functioning of the Threat Prevention software. It is responsible for hooking into the Windows operating system to intercept and analyze system activities, helping to identify and prevent potential security threats.

This makes wchook.dll an important component in ensuring the security and performance of the McAfee Endpoint Security Threat Prevention software within computer systems.

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:

  • The file wchook.dll is missing: The specified DLL file couldn't be found. It may have been unintentionally deleted or moved from its original location.
  • Wchook.dll could not be loaded: This error indicates that the DLL file, necessary for certain operations, couldn't be loaded by the system. Potential causes might include missing DLL files, DLL files that are not properly registered in the system, or conflicts with other software.
  • Wchook.dll Access Violation: This message indicates that a program has tried to access memory that it shouldn't. It could be caused by software bugs, outdated drivers, or conflicts between software.
  • This application failed to start because wchook.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This message suggests that the application is trying to run a DLL file that it can't locate, which may be due to deletion or displacement of the DLL file. Reinstallation could potentially restore the necessary DLL file to its correct location.
  • Cannot register wchook.dll: This denotes a failure in the system's attempt to register the DLL file, which might occur if the DLL file is damaged, if the system lacks the necessary permissions, or if there's a conflict with another registered DLL.
